I was working on the spurios interrupt problem and
I noticed something weird.

static int virtnet_poll_tx(struct napi_struct *napi, int budget)
{       
        struct send_queue *sq = container_of(napi, struct send_queue, napi);
        struct virtnet_info *vi = sq->vq->vdev->priv;
        unsigned int index = vq2txq(sq->vq);
        struct netdev_queue *txq;

        if (unlikely(is_xdp_raw_buffer_queue(vi, index))) {
                /* We don't need to enable cb for XDP */
                napi_complete_done(napi, 0);
                return 0;
        }

        txq = netdev_get_tx_queue(vi->dev, index);
        __netif_tx_lock(txq, raw_smp_processor_id());
        free_old_xmit_skbs(sq, true);
        __netif_tx_unlock(txq);
        
        virtqueue_napi_complete(napi, sq->vq, 0);
        
        if (sq->vq->num_free >= 2 + MAX_SKB_FRAGS)
                netif_tx_wake_queue(txq);
        
        return 0;
}       

So virtqueue_napi_complete is called when txq is not locked,
thinkably start_xmit can happen right?

Now virtqueue_napi_complete

static void virtqueue_napi_complete(struct napi_struct *napi,
                                    struct virtqueue *vq, int processed)
{
        int opaque;

        opaque = virtqueue_enable_cb_prepare(vq);
        if (napi_complete_done(napi, processed)) {
                if (unlikely(virtqueue_poll(vq, opaque)))
                        virtqueue_napi_schedule(napi, vq);
        } else {
                virtqueue_disable_cb(vq);
        }
}


So it is calling virtqueue_enable_cb_prepare but tx queue
could be running and can process things in parallel ...
What gives? I suspect this corrupts the ring, and explains
why we are seeing weird hangs with vhost packed ring ...

Jason?

and wouldn't the following untested patch make sense then?


diff --git a/drivers/net/virtio_net.c b/drivers/net/virtio_net.c
index 82e520d2cb12..c23341b18eb5 100644
--- a/drivers/net/virtio_net.c
+++ b/drivers/net/virtio_net.c
@@ -1504,6 +1505,8 @@ static int virtnet_poll_tx(struct napi_struct *napi, int budget)
 	struct virtnet_info *vi = sq->vq->vdev->priv;
 	unsigned int index = vq2txq(sq->vq);
 	struct netdev_queue *txq;
+	int opaque;
+	bool done;
 
 	if (unlikely(is_xdp_raw_buffer_queue(vi, index))) {
 		/* We don't need to enable cb for XDP */
@@ -1514,9 +1517,26 @@ static int virtnet_poll_tx(struct napi_struct *napi, int budget)
 	txq = netdev_get_tx_queue(vi->dev, index);
 	__netif_tx_lock(txq, raw_smp_processor_id());
 	free_old_xmit_skbs(sq, true);
+
+	opaque = virtqueue_enable_cb_prepare(sq->vq);
+
+	done = napi_complete_done(napi, 0);
+
+	if (!done)
+		virtqueue_disable_cb(sq->vq);
+
 	__netif_tx_unlock(txq);
 
-	virtqueue_napi_complete(napi, sq->vq, 0);
+	if (done) {
+		if (unlikely(virtqueue_poll(vq, opaque))) {
+			if (napi_schedule_prep(napi)) {
+				__netif_tx_lock(txq, raw_smp_processor_id());
+				virtqueue_disable_cb(sq->vq);
+				__netif_tx_unlock(txq);
+				__napi_schedule(napi);
+			}
+		}
+	}
 
 	if (sq->vq->num_free >= 2 + MAX_SKB_FRAGS)
 		netif_tx_wake_queue(txq);
